FEATURE: Quick Review
PURPOSE: To check the end of the last
recording.
OPERATION: 1) Press “ ” and release quickly
during the Record-Standby mode.
n Tape is rewound for about 2
seconds and played back
automatically, then pauses in
Record-Standby mode for the
next shot.
NOTE:
Distortion may occur at start of
playback. This is normal.
FEATURE: Retake
PURPOSE: To re-record certain segments.
OPERATION: 1) Make sure the camcorder is in the
Record-Standby mode.
2) Press either RETAKE button to
reach the start point for new
recording. Pressing “F” forwards
the tape and pressing “R” reverses
it.
3) Press Recording Start/Stop Button
to start recording.
NOTE:
Noise may appear during Retake.
This is normal.
FEATURE: Picture Stabilizer
PURPOSE: To compensate for unstable images
caused by camera-shake, particularly
at high magnification.
OPERATION: 1) Press P. STABILIZER. “
”appears.
n To switch off the Picture
Stabilizer, press P. STABILIZER.
The indicator disappears.
NOTES:
Accurate stabilization may not be
possible if hand shake is excessive,
or under the following conditions:
When shooting subjects with
vertical or horizontal stripes.
When shooting dark or dim
subjects.
When shooting subjects with
excessive backlighting.
When shooting scenes with
movement in various directions.
When shooting scenes with low-
contrast backgrounds.
Switch off the Picture Stabilizer
when recording with the
camcorder on a tripod.
